Main -> Local -> Node -> Load Defaults

This feature sets the node ID back to zero and clears all channel mapping information for this node. The topology is retained.

Main -> Local -> Optics:

Optic Menu

1. Transmit

2.Receive

3.Info

Information about the fiber optic transceivers can be accessed from the sub-menus.

Main -> Local -> Optics -> Transmit:

Tx Optic A B C D

4.23 mW

Status: Good

This screen shows the optical launch power of the selected optic transceiver. Use the "+" button to select the next transceiver. Use the "-" button to select the previous transceiver.

The launch power is displayed in milliwatts (mW). Values around +4mW are normal. Additionally, the transceiver transmit (TX) status is displayed. The status is reported as either Good, Faulty, or Not Found if the selected transceiver is not installed.

Main -> Local -> Optics -> Receive:

Rx Optic: ABCD

3.97mW

Status: Good

This screen shows the optical receive power of the selected optic transceiver. Use the "+" button to select the next transceiver. Use the "-" button to select the previous transceiver.

The power is displayed in milliwatts (mW). The receive power can be used to verify path loss if the transmit launch power at the other end of a fiber is known. Sensitivity must be greater than 0.04 mW to insure enough optical power is being received. Additionally, the transceiver receive (RX) status is displayed. The status is reported as Good, Sync Loss, Signal Loss or Not Found if the selected transceiver is not installed.
